With a disability health insurance coverage rates in Kansas City, Missouri compared

How does Kansas City, Missouri compare to other Missouri and National averages?

  • Kansas City, Missouri

    91.1%

  • Missouri

    94.8% (4% higher than Kansas City, Missouri)

  • National average

    94.9% (4% higher than Kansas City, Missouri)
